The one that is out and useful is the cleaner shrimp. You will never see peppermint shrimp and the coral banded shrimp are aggressive. Sexy shrimp need anemone or else they will be fish food.
Get two cleaner shrimp. They are beautiful useful and long live 5-7 years or so.
They are all hardy but Sexy shrimp are too small and will get eaten quickly by any fish that hunt for pods.
